 Art Foundations high school students have been chosen for the Center for the Visual Arts at their gallery in Wausau which is currently hosting the.. 
7th Congressional District Art Competition Exhibit
The CVA will showcase this artwork in upcoming social media posts for Memorial Day in a few weeks and Veterans Day in the fall. They plan to attribute the artists and the names of the pieces directly in the post. Students in class, under the direction of art teacher Mrs. Maryann Gumness and her student teacher Rachel Gatti, were directed to connect their painting and their writing in connection with what is America.  Winners are Junior - Kayle Klatt and Sophomore Josh Bresina. Congratulations!
